:root{--color-tsuchill-green: #C8FFDC;--color-green: #5DA88C;--color-yellow-green: #5F8A6A;--color-beige: #F8F6F0;--bg-gray: #F6F6F6}.is-style-box-color-bgwhite{padding:32px;margin:2em 0;background-color:#fff;border:1px solid #ccc}.is-style-box-color-bgwhite *:first-child{margin-top:0 !important}.is-style-box-color-bgwhite *:last-child{margin-bottom:0 !important}.is-style-box-color-bgblack{padding:32px;margin:2em 0;background-color:#e6e6e6;border:1px solid gray}.is-style-box-color-bgblack *:first-child{margin-top:0 !important}.is-style-box-color-bgblack *:last-child{margin-bottom:0 !important}.is-style-box-color-bgred{padding:32px;margin:2em 0;background-color:#f3dddd;border:1px solid #e1adad}.is-style-box-color-bgred *:first-child{margin-top:0 !important}.is-style-box-color-bgred *:last-child{margin-bottom:0 !important}.is-style-box-color-bgbrown{padding:32px;margin:2em 0;background-color:#eee6dd;border:1px solid #bfa182}.is-style-box-color-bgbrown *:first-child{margin-top:0 !important}.is-style-box-color-bgbrown *:last-child{margin-bottom:0 !important}.is-style-box-color-bgorange{padding:32px;margin:2em 0;background-color:#f8e6dd;border:1px solid #e49f7c}.is-style-box-color-bgorange *:first-child{margin-top:0 !important}.is-style-box-color-bgorange *:last-child{margin-bottom:0 !important}.is-style-box-color-bgyellow{padding:32px;margin:2em 0;background-color:#f7f1de;border:1px solid #e1c87f}.is-style-box-color-bgyellow *:first-child{margin-top:0 !important}.is-style-box-color-bgyellow *:last-child{margin-bottom:0 !important}.is-style-box-color-bggreen{padding:32px;margin:2em 0;background-color:#dfecdf;border:1px solid #8ab78a}.is-style-box-color-bggreen *:first-child{margin-top:0 !important}.is-style-box-color-bggreen *:last-child{margin-bottom:0 !important}.is-style-box-color-bgcyan{padding:32px;margin:2em 0;background-color:#e4f1f1;border:1px solid #96caca}.is-style-box-color-bgcyan *:first-child{margin-top:0 !important}.is-style-box-color-bgcyan *:last-child{margin-bottom:0 !important}.is-style-box-color-bgblue{padding:32px;margin:2em 0;background-color:#e6e6f5;border:1px solid #9b9bd4}.is-style-box-color-bgblue *:first-child{margin-top:0 !important}.is-style-box-color-bgblue *:last-child{margin-bottom:0 !important}.is-style-box-color-bgviolet{padding:32px;margin:2em 0;background-color:#eee7f3;border:1px solid #b99fcb}.is-style-box-color-bgviolet *:first-child{margin-top:0 !important}.is-style-box-color-bgviolet *:last-child{margin-bottom:0 !important}.is-style-box-color-bgpink{padding:32px;margin:2em 0;background-color:#f7e9f0;border:1px solid #dfaac4}.is-style-box-color-bgpink *:first-child{margin-top:0 !important}.is-style-box-color-bgpink *:last-child{margin-bottom:0 !important}.is-style-box-color-tsuchillgreen{padding:32px;margin:2em 0;background-color:#c8ffdc;border:1px solid #5da88c}.is-style-box-color-tsuchillgreen *:first-child{margin-top:0 !important}.is-style-box-color-tsuchillgreen *:last-child{margin-bottom:0 !important}.is-style-vk-group-dashed{padding:32px}.is-style-vk-group-dashed *:first-child{margin-top:0 !important}.is-style-vk-group-dashed *:last-child{margin-bottom:0 !important}.is-style-blockquote-cite{display:block;margin-block-start:5px;font-size:.8em;color:#737373;text-align:right}.is-style-border-line-radius{overflow:hidden;border:2px solid #000;border-radius:16px}.is-style-border-line-radius iframe,.is-style-border-line-radius img,.is-style-border-line-radius picture{line-height:1;vertical-align:middle}.is-style-border-line-radius .is-style-border-line-radius{margin-bottom:0;border:none}.is-style-next-page-title{padding:32px 24px;margin:56px 0 0;font-weight:bold;line-height:1.5 !important;color:var(--color-green);background:#f2eee9}.is-style-next-page-title::before{display:block;margin-block-end:8px;font-size:14px;color:#000;content:"【次ページ】"}.is-style-caution-note{padding:16px;margin:2em 0;font-size:13px;border:1px dashed #ccc}.is-style-gallery-flex-no-grow.wp-block-gallery.has-nested-images figure.wp-block-image{flex-grow:0}.is-style-gallery-album-title{display:flex;gap:8px;align-items:center;margin-block-end:16px !important;font-weight:bold}.is-style-gallery-album-title::before{display:block;flex-shrink:0;width:26px;height:21px;content:"";background:url("../../../img/common/icon_gallery.svg") no-repeat;background-size:contain}@media screen and (max-width: 598px){.is-style-box-color-bgwhite{padding:16px}.is-style-box-color-bgblack{padding:16px}.is-style-box-color-bgred{padding:16px}.is-style-box-color-bgbrown{padding:16px}.is-style-box-color-bgorange{padding:16px}.is-style-box-color-bgyellow{padding:16px}.is-style-box-color-bggreen{padding:16px}.is-style-box-color-bgcyan{padding:16px}.is-style-box-color-bgblue{padding:16px}.is-style-box-color-bgviolet{padding:16px}.is-style-box-color-bgpink{padding:16px}.is-style-box-color-tsuchillgreen{padding:16px}.is-style-vk-group-dashed{padding:16px}}@media screen and (min-width: 599px){.is-style-box-width-80{max-width:80%}.is-style-box-width-50{max-width:50%}}